Forum

Einloggen | Registrieren | RSS  

Keine Funktionsrückgabe (Computertechnik)

verfasst von Esel(R)  E-Mail, Dormagen, 30.03.2012, 18:49 Uhr

» Hallo liebe Gemeinde.
»
» Ich habe folgenden Quellcode geschrieben:
»
» include
» using namespace std;
»
» float Flaeche (float Laenge, float Breite)
» {
» return Laenge*Breite;
» }
»
» int main()
» {
» float Laenge, Breite;
»
» cout << "Die Flaeche Ihres Gartens soll ermittelt werden!" << endl;
» cout << "Wie lang ist Ihr Garten?" << endl;
» cin >> Laenge;
» cout << "Wie breit ist Ihr Garten?" << endl;
» cin >> Breite;
»
» float Flaeche_Garten = Flaeche(Laenge,Breite);
»
» return 0;
» }
»
» Der Compiler hat keinen Fehler ausgegeben.
»
» Jedoch wird die Fläche nicht ausgerechnet, siehe Bild:
»
»
»
»
»
» Was habe ich falsch gemacht? Ich sehe den Fehler nicht.
»
» Vielen Dank im Voraus für die Antworten.
»
» Gruß
»
» Max

Wie soll er auch was anzeigen, wenn du das Programm nicht so erstellst?

Das ich C programmiert habe, ist zwar schon etwas länger her. Aber wie wärs mit:

z.B.

printf("Die Flaeche wurde errechnet und betraegt: %fn", Flaeche_Garten);

Gruß Esel

--
Esel sind die besten Tiere!
Wenn jemand etwas gegen Esel hat, so legt er sich mit dem Heiligen Geist persönlich an ;)



Gesamter Thread:

Keine Funktionsrückgabe - silent_max(R), 30.03.2012, 18:35 (Computertechnik)
Hat sich erledigt - silent_max(R), 30.03.2012, 18:48
Keine Funktionsrückgabe - Esel(R), 30.03.2012, 18:49